But let's talk about the humble beginnings of the Equinox Hotel.

1:20.8

Back in 1769, there was an establishment here called Marsh Tavern.

1:25.0

Hey, we were England back then.

1:26.9

That's right. Marsh Tavern was a tavern

1:29.2

and an inn. It was a place for travelers and locals to gather. It was also the kind of place where people

1:34.9

talked and schemed about the early American Revolution. People like Ira Allen, one of the Green Mountain

1:41.2

Boys and the younger brother of Ethan Allen. In Marsh Tavern,

1:44.9

they discussed seizing the land of British loyalists to raise money to fund their militia.
